WebApr 8, 2013 · Red ear syndrome (RES) is characterised by attacks of unilateral or bilateral burning ear pain associated with erythema. Primary and secondary forms have been described. Primary RES appears to have a frequent association with primary headaches especially migraine. Here, we describe the case of a woman with short-lasting unilateral … WebJan 13, 2024 · The frequent relationship between RES and migraine suggests that it is necessary to investigate the syndrome in migraineurs, and new reports about this disorder are important to increase the knowledge of physicians, to reduce the delay in diagnosis and suffering of patients. WebDec 17, 2024 · Red Ear Syndrome is a rare phenomenon characterized by attacks of burning sensations and reddening of one or both ears. This condition has been primarily associated with migraine as well as trigeminal autonomiccephalalgias.
